Pripet in Waldo County (Maine) is a town in United States about 566 mi (or 911 km) north-east of Washington DC, the country's capital city.
Current time in Pripet is now 02:55 PM (Wednesday). The local timezone is named America / New York with an UTC offset of -4 hours. We know of 11 airports near Pripet, of which 5 are larger airports. The closest airport in United States is Hancock County-Bar Harbor Airport in a distance of 26 mi (or 41 km), East. Besides the airports, there are other travel options available (check left side).
